9月 29, 2025, Torre Troiana o dell'Orologio
The Torre Troiana was built in the 13th century and is 44 meters high. It has a square base measuring 5.90 meters on each side and a narrow, curved dome. To visit, you must purchase a ticket for €10 at the tourist office. This ticket allows access to five attractions; you cannot purchase a ticket at the tower itself.

9月 24, 2025, Collegiata di San Secondo
Divided into three naves by twelve pillars supporting arches and cross vaults on a Latin cross plan, the church contains works of great artistic value by painters of the 16th and 17th centuries. Of note are the carved choir and wooden lectern, commissioned by Bishop Innocenzo Migliavacca at the end of the 17th century. At the end of the nave is the Chapel of San Secondo, built between 1772 and 1789 to a design by Bernardo Antonio Vittone.

5月 4, 2025, Piazza Principale di Castelnuovo Calcea
With a plaque for the "Martyrs of Freedom": Ferrero Domenico Ferruccio from Castelnuovo was a partisan in the Giustizia & Liberta formations, killed in action on March 26, 1945, during the fighting in Agliano, not far from here. http://intranet.istoreto.it/partigianato/dettaglio.asp?id=35746 Bianco Luigi Loris was a farmer from Castelnuovo and a partisan in an autonomous unit. He was captured during a clearing operation on December 6, 1944, and deported to Germany. He died during the death march from Flossenbürg to Dachau. https://israt.it/banche-dati/deportati-politici-astigiani.html https://www.pietredellamemoria.it/pietre/monumento-ai-caduti-di-castelnuovo-calcea/

6月 4, 2022, Collegiata di San Secondo
The Collegiate Church of San Secondo is one of the oldest Gothic churches in Asti. With the adjacent municipal seat and opposite the square of the same name, it forms the heart of the city. Dedicated to San Secondo, patron saint of the city, it was built according to tradition on the site of his martyrdom and burial. The exact time of its foundation is not known, the oldest document mentioning the church dates from August 1, 880. Don't forget to visit the Crypt: Explanation: The pre-Romanesque layout of the church cannot be reconstructed in any way, except for the presence of the crypt; the oldest part dates from the 6th/7th century, consisting of four small columns surmounted by Corinthian imitation capitals with a double order of leaves. Two side walls and two wrought iron gates delimit the "cella confessionis", inside which is the sixteenth century reliquary, in silver, with the bones of the martyr from Asti.

12月 24, 2021, Piazza Castagnole Monferrato
In 1306 the town with other localities was given as a pledge to Charles of Provenza by the Marquis of Saluzzo, who had a close relationship with him, because he refused to accept the recognition of Theodore I Palaiologos, second-born son of Andronicus and Violante, as one Lord of Monferrato. In 1309, the representatives of Castagnole took part in a Parliament in Chivasso and are also present in the following ones: Castagnole is therefore now an integral part of the State and its fate follows. The Palaeologus of Monferrato had multiple confirmations of their dominion over the village, including the diploma of Emperor Charles IV in 1355 and that of Maximilian I, in 1494. In 1391 the castle and the town hosted the troops of Facino Cane, the fearsome leader of fortune, in those years employed by the Marquis Teodoro II.
